Reasons to Choose a Group Home for Your Loved One with Disability

When you have a family member or a loved one with a disability, deciding on their living arrangements is something that you and your family will have to do in the future.

This said, as a provider of residential care in Maryland ourselves, we know that although knowing this fact will make the whole thing easier, it does not erase the fact that you would have to part with them eventually.

Let us help you come to terms with this and clear your hesitations by enumerating the benefits of having them taken care of in our group home in Owings Mills, Maryland at Standard Integrated Supports, Inc. Take a look below:

  • They can enjoy a home-like environment
    It is not easy to be away from home, no matter what age you’re in, and especially if you live with a disability. We understand this at our group home so we make sure to maintain a warm and familial environment that feels just like a home away from home.
  • They can engage and enjoy social interactions
    Your loved one may not have had opportunities to keep a social circle at home. Our group home practically makes it impossible for them to be isolated since peer interaction and social life comes hand-in-hand with staying in a group home.
  • They can be attended to 24/7 professionally
    One of the most common issues when taking care of a loved one with a disability is the unavailability of a regular caregiver, especially if you haven’t hired a care professional to attend to them. A group home guarantees that they will be attended to through our developmental disability services delivered by a well-trained professional care team day-in and day-out.
